Predictive Value for Outcome and Evolution of Geriatric Parameters after Transcatheter Aortic Valve Implantation

Insights

Comprehensive geriatric assessment (CGA) identifies poor outcomes after TAVI. Most CGA parameters remain stable at 6 months, but cognitive function evolves based on prior status.

Background:

  • Transcatheter Aortic Valve Implantation (TAVI) is a crucial procedure for elderly patients with aortic stenosis.
  • Assessing frailty and geriatric parameters is vital for predicting outcomes in this population.
  • Comprehensive Geriatric Assessment (CGA) offers a multidomain evaluation of older adults' health status.

Purpose of the Study:

  • To identify Comprehensive Geriatric Assessment (CGA) parameters, including the ABCDEF score, associated with adverse outcomes following TAVI.
  • To evaluate the changes in CGA parameters at a 6-month follow-up after TAVI.

Main Methods:

  • A prospective, monocentric cohort study involving 114 patients over 70 years old selected for TAVI.
  • 8-area CGA was performed pre-TAVI and at 6-month follow-up.
  • Poor outcome was defined as a decline in basic activities of daily living (BADL), unplanned readmission, or all-cause mortality within one year.

Main Results:

  • 50% of patients experienced poor outcomes.
  • Independent predictors of poor outcome included loss of one BADL, decreased instrumental activities of daily living (IADL), lower plasmatic albumin, reduced Mini-Mental State Examination (MMSE) scores, slower walking speed, and an ABCDEF score of 2 or higher.
  • At 6 months, most geriatric parameters were stable in survivors, except for a significant decrease in IADL. The MMSE showed improvement in those with prior cognitive impairment but decline in others.

Conclusions:

  • Comprehensive Geriatric Assessment (CGA) parameters are significant independent predictors of poor outcomes post-TAVI.
  • While most CGA parameters remain stable at 6 months, IADL shows a decline, and the trajectory of cognitive function (MMSE) is influenced by baseline cognitive status.
